### Permission Management
Permissions control which hostnames users can update.
```bash
# List all permissions
ddns-service permission list
# List permissions for specific user
ddns-service permission list --user myuser
# Add permission for exact hostname
ddns-service permission add myuser mypc dyn.example.com
# Add wildcard permission (any hostname in zone)
ddns-service permission add myuser '*' dyn.example.com
# Add suffix wildcard (e.g., *.home matches foo.home, bar.home)
ddns-service permission add myuser '*.home' dyn.example.com
# Delete permission
ddns-service permission delete myuser mypc dyn.example.com
```
**Pattern matching:**
- `*` - matches any hostname in the zone
- `*.suffix` - matches hostnames ending in `.suffix` (recursive)
- `exact` - matches only that exact hostname
